欢迎光临
我们一直在努力

后端教程

后端教程

LeetCode总结 -- 树的遍历篇

遍历树的数据结构中最常见的操作, 可以说大部分关于树的题目都是围绕遍历进行变体来解决的。 一般来说面试中遇到树的题目是用递归来解决的, 不过如果直接考察遍历, 那么一般递归的解法就过于简单了, 面试官一般还会问更多问题, 比如非递归实现, 或者空间复杂度分析以及能否优化等等

后端教程

php – 使用Google地图进行邻近搜索

我正在开发一个商店位置应用程序. 查找商店,它目前根据地址和邮政编码显示googlemaps中的位置. 现在我想要建立一个功能,该功能还显示了半径500米范围内的其他商店. 为此,我必须进行邻近搜索/计算. 我最大的问题是,我应该如何处理这个问题. 我做了find this link,它有一些示例代码.但我不确定我是否可以使用代码(以及我应该使用哪些代码).有没有人有更好的例子? 此外,我正在考虑向数据库添加一个新表,该表存储每个商店的地理代码

后端教程

python3 -> 函数注释 Function Annotations

函数注释 Function Annotations》” /> Python 3.X新增加了一个特性(Feature),叫作 函数注释 Function Annotations 它的用途虽然不是语法级别的硬性要求,但是顾名思义,它可做为函数额外的注释来用

后端教程

在WPF图像控件中,Tiff图像未显示实际大小

我一直在研究 WPF应用程序,需要能够以实际大小显示多页tiff并适合屏幕.我从另一个StackOverflow线程获得的代码非常适合以实际大小显示其中的一些,但是新扫描的大约1700 x 800的tiff文件显示为大约600 x 400. 我想要实现的基本上是Windows Photo Viewer如何显示图像的副本.您可以看到它们适合屏幕,或按一个按钮,如果需要,它会使用滚动条缩放到实际大小.我有2个tiffs工作. 1是从mspaint保存为tiff的JPEG,另一个(2)是较旧的扫描文档

后端教程

Python实用技巧总结

以下是我近些年收集的一些Python实用技巧和工具,希望能对你有所帮助。 交换变量 x = 6 y = 5 x, y = y, x print x >>> 5 print y >>> 6 if 语句在行内 print “Hello” if True else “World” >>> Hello 连接 下面的最后一种方式在绑定两个不同类型的对象时显得很cool

后端教程

import提升导致Fundebug报错:“请配置apikey”

摘要: 解释一下“请配置apikey”报错的原因。 部分Fundebug用户使用import来导入js文件时,出现了”请配置apikey”的报错,这是由于import提升导致的,下面我会详细解释一下这一点。 import提升 关于import提升,我们可以参考阮一峰的《ECMAScript 6 入门》。 import命令具有提升效果,会提升到整个模块的头部,首先执行

后端教程

MySQL 8.0.16安装教程(windows 64位)

话不多说直接开干   目录 1-先去官网下载点击的MySQL的下载​ 2-配置初始化的my.ini文件的文件 3-初始化MySQL 4-安装MySQL服务 + 启动MySQL 服务 5-连接MySQL + 修改密码     先去官网下载点击的MySQL的下载 下载完成后解压  解压完是这个样子     配置初始化的my.ini文件的文件 解压后的目录并没有的my.ini文件,没关系可以自行创建在安装根目录下添加的my

后端教程

哈希表

哈希表 大致介绍 1、哈希表的本质是一个数组; 2、数组中每一个元素称为一个箱子; 3、它通过把关键码值映射到表中一个位置(箱子的位置)来访问记录,以加快查找的速度; 4、映射函数叫做散列函数(也叫哈希函数),存放记录的数组叫做散列表,也就是哈希表; 哈希表的存储过程如下 根据 key 计算出它的哈希值 h。 假设箱子的个数为 n,那么这个键值对应该放在第 ( (h % n)——一种散列算法)个箱子中。 如果该箱子中已经有了键值对,就使用开放寻址法或者 拉链法解决(1.7及之前的HashMap) 冲突

后端教程

python入坑第十二天|函数(1)

我们之前学过了print()、input()等内置函数,那么有的蛇友就会问了,我们可不可以自己定义函数呢?那当然是肯定的,虽然python有很多内置函数,但这是满足不了我们的需求的,这时候就需要我们自己定义函数了

后端教程

python – 在机械化中,无论如何都要重写URL到表单中的POST?

我正在运行 python脚本,我正在使用机械化.我正在尝试提交的表单通常使用 javascript重写要POST的URL,因此要正确提交表单我需要手动执行相同操作.无论如何这样做? 最佳答案 Mechanize不处理 Javascript.最好的方法通常是使用浏览器来处理Javascript – 如果你喜欢在Python中使用 PythonExt. 您也可以尝试Selenium – seleniumhq.org.它用于网站测试,但也可以发送表单.